Holistic Therapist

Holistic therapy offers a whole body solution to promote balance and well-being. The holistic therapist will analyze the client's health and devise a treatment plan that can include massage, reflexology and aromatherapy to result in physical and emotional well-being. For those who prefer natural forms of pain relief and restoration, the holistic therapist can advise on treatments to remedy a variety of ailments.


Reiki

Reiki is a form of spiritual healing that hails from ancient Japan. This treatment is based on encouraging natural healing within the body by the use of non touch massage and meditation. Reiki can help to alleviate stresses and strains while balancing the body and mind. Clients are left with a feeling of deep relaxation and emotional release after the treatment.


Reflexology

Reflexology is an alternative treatment that focuses on applying pressure to points of the feet that trigger healing in other areas of the body. By gently rubbing and massaging key nerve endings on the foot, other organs in the body are encouraged to rejuvenate and balance. Reflexology can be used to treat a wide variety of problems ranging from migraines to nausea.


Indian Head

Practiced as part of the Indian Ayurvedic system of healing for over 1000 years, Indian head massage is used to release tension and stress that has built up in the head, face, neck and shoulders. Joints, tissue and muscle are treated to a deeply relaxing massage that releases pressure and eliminates built up toxins. Indian head massage can provide relief from stress, sinusitis, insomnia, migraines and headaches whilst promoting a general rebalancing of the whole body by releasing toxins and producing a calm state of mind.
